Summer Trail Clean
Hope Valley Climate Action, a community led charity has recently become a TFT Community Hub in the Peak District!
We’re heading out for a roam in Castleton in the Hope Valley with our litter pickers at hand. Grab your family, friends, and come on down for a morning stroll (but with a purpose!).
Start time: 10am - allows you to reach the walk by local buses - no. 272 and 62.
Where we’ll go: Starting at Castleton Visitor Centre we'll begin a relaxed 2.2 miles walk over the fields towards the old broken road, enjoying scenic views of Mam Tor then coming back along Old Mam Tor road, finishing back at the visitor centre where toilets and refreshments are available.
The route should take around 1 hour 45 minutes including a couple of stops along the way. As well as enjoying the outdoors we’ll be removing as much litter as possible along the trail, then later we’ll count it all up and submit our findings to the Trash Free Trails Report!
Everyone will be provided with a litter picker and a bag but please bring a pair of gloves – see below on what else to bring.
